Flax seed oil is nature's most concentrated source of alpha- linolenic acid (ALA), an essential omega-3 fatty acid. Douglas Laboratories™ Organic Flax Seed Oil provides 55- 60% ALA, as well as significant amounts of oleic acid and the essential linoleic acid in their natural triglyceride forms. Organic Flax Seed Oil is extracted without the damaging effects of heat, light, and oxygen using a mechanical expeller press.
